Features

    • Ultra-low RDS(on): 6.6mO typical
    • True 7A current capability
    • Power rail switching from sub-1V to 5.5V
    • Bias voltage form 2.7V to 9V
    • =1µA OFF-state bias supply current
    • =1µA OFF-state power switch leakage current
    • Adjustable slew rate for inrush current limiting by external capacitor
    • Load discharge
    • TTL-compatible control input
    • 10-pin 1.2mm × 2.0mm QFN package, 0.5mm pin pitch
    • –40°C to +125°C junction temperature range

Description

The MIC95410 is a high-side load switch for computing and ultra-dense embedded computing boards where high-current low-voltage rails from sub-1V to 5.5V have to be sectioned. The integrated 6.6mΩ RDS(ON) N-channel MOSFET ensures low voltage drop and low power dissipation while delivering up to 7A of load current. The MIC95410 is internally powered by a separated bias voltage from 2.7V to 9V. It includes a TTL-logic level to gate a voltage translator driving a charge pump, and an output discharge function when disabled. The OFF-state current from bias supply (VS) and the power switch OFF-state leakage current (IOFF) are both below 1μA. The MIC95410 provides user-adjustable slew-rate-controlled turn-on to limit the inrush current to the input supply voltage. The MIC95410 is available in a thermally efficient, space-saving 10-pin 1.2mm x 2.0mm QFN package with 0.5mm pin pitch and an operating junction temperature range from –40°C to +125°C.
